High, tall, lofty mean above the average in height High implies marked extension upward and is applied chiefly to things which rise from a base or foundation or are placed at a conspicuous height above a lower level.

If something is high, it is a long way above the ground, above sea level, or above a person or thing I looked down from the high window The bridge was high, jacked up on wooden piers The sun was high in the sky, blazing down on us.

High, lofty, tall, towering refer to something that has considerable height

High is a general term, and denotes either extension upward or position at a considerable height High adjective (important) b2 having power, an important position, or great influence An officer of high rank The words lofty and tall are common synonyms of high

While all three words mean above the average in height, high implies marked extension upward and is applied chiefly to things which rise from a base or foundation or are placed at a conspicuous height above a lower level.
